Automatic generation produced by ISE Eiffel

Classes Clusters Cluster hierarchy Chart Relations Flat contracts Go to:
class SD_ZONE_NAVIGATION_DIALOG General cluster: implementation_mswin description: "Window allow user to navigate among all zones. The original version of this class was generated by EiffelBuild." create: make Ancestors EV_SHARED_APPLICATION SD_ACCESS* SD_ZONE_NAVIGATION_DIALOG_IMP* Action sequences close_request_actions: EV_NOTIFY_ACTION_SEQUENCE conforming_pick_actions: EV_NOTIFY_ACTION_SEQUENCE dock_ended_actions: EV_NOTIFY_ACTION_SEQUENCE dock_started_actions: EV_NOTIFY_ACTION_SEQUENCE docked_actions: EV_DOCKABLE_SOURCE_ACTION_SEQUENCE dpi_changed_actions: EV_DPI_ACTION_SEQUENCE drop_actions: EV_PND_ACTION_SEQUENCE file_drop_actions: EV_LITE_ACTION_SEQUENCE [LIST [STRING_32]] focus_in_actions: EV_NOTIFY_ACTION_SEQUENCE focus_out_actions: EV_NOTIFY_ACTION_SEQUENCE hide_actions: EV_NOTIFY_ACTION_SEQUENCE key_press_actions: EV_KEY_ACTION_SEQUENCE key_press_string_actions: EV_KEY_STRING_ACTION_SEQUENCE key_release_actions: EV_KEY_ACTION_SEQUENCE mouse_wheel_actions: EV_INTEGER_ACTION_SEQUENCE move_actions: EV_GEOMETRY_ACTION_SEQUENCE pick_actions: EV_PND_START_ACTION_SEQUENCE pick_ended_actions: EV_PND_FINISHED_ACTION_SEQUENCE pointer_button_press_actions: EV_POINTER_BUTTON_ACTION_SEQUENCE pointer_button_release_actions: EV_POINTER_BUTTON_ACTION_SEQUENCE pointer_double_press_actions: EV_POINTER_BUTTON_ACTION_SEQUENCE pointer_enter_actions: EV_NOTIFY_ACTION_SEQUENCE pointer_leave_actions: EV_NOTIFY_ACTION_SEQUENCE pointer_motion_actions: EV_POINTER_MOTION_ACTION_SEQUENCE resize_actions: EV_GEOMETRY_ACTION_SEQUENCE show_actions: EV_NOTIFY_ACTION_SEQUENCE Queries accelerators: EV_ACCELERATOR_LIST accept_cursor: EV_POINTER_STYLE actual_drop_target_agent: detachable FUNCTION [INTEGER_32, INTEGER_32, detachable EV_ABSTRACT_PICK_AND_DROPABLE] background_color: EV_COLOR background_pixmap: detachable EV_PIXMAP Changeable_comparison_criterion: BOOLEAN client_height: INTEGER_32 client_width: INTEGER_32 configurable_target_menu_handler: detachable PROCEDURE [EV_MENU, ARRAYED_LIST [EV_PND_TARGET_DATA], EV_PICK_AND_DROPABLE, detachable ANY] count: INTEGER_32 data: detachable ANY debug_output: STRING_32 default_identifier_name: STRING_32 default_key_processing_handler: detachable PREDICATE [EV_KEY] deny_cursor: EV_POINTER_STYLE description: EV_LABEL detail: EV_LABEL dpi: NATURAL_32 ev_application: EV_APPLICATION ev_separate_application: separate EV_APPLICATION extendible: BOOLEAN files_column: SD_TOOL_BAR foreground_color: EV_COLOR full: BOOLEAN full_identifier_path: STRING_32 full_title: EV_LABEL has (v: EV_WIDGET): BOOLEAN has_capture: BOOLEAN has_focus: BOOLEAN has_identifier_name_set: BOOLEAN has_parent: BOOLEAN has_recursive (an_item: [like item] EV_WIDGET): BOOLEAN has_shadow: BOOLEAN height: INTEGER_32 help_context: detachable FUNCTION [EV_HELP_CONTEXT] id_freed: BOOLEAN id_object (an_id: INTEGER_32): detachable IDENTIFIED identifier_name: STRING_32 internal_files_box: EV_HORIZONTAL_BOX internal_files_label: EV_LABEL internal_info_box: EV_VERTICAL_BOX internal_info_box_border: EV_VERTICAL_BOX internal_label_box: EV_HORIZONTAL_BOX internal_tools_box: EV_HORIZONTAL_BOX internal_tools_label: EV_LABEL internal_vertical_box_top: EV_VERTICAL_BOX internal_vertical_box_top_top: EV_HORIZONTAL_BOX is_background_color_void: BOOLEAN is_border_enabled: BOOLEAN is_destroyed: BOOLEAN is_displayed: BOOLEAN is_dockable: BOOLEAN is_docking_enabled: BOOLEAN is_empty: BOOLEAN is_external_docking_enabled: BOOLEAN is_external_docking_relative: BOOLEAN is_foreground_color_void: BOOLEAN is_in_default_state: BOOLEAN is_inserted (v: EV_WIDGET): BOOLEAN is_parent_recursive (a_widget: EV_WIDGET): BOOLEAN is_sensitive: BOOLEAN is_show_requested: BOOLEAN item: EV_WIDGET linear_representation: LINEAR [[like item] EV_WIDGET] Maximum_dimension: INTEGER_32 maximum_height: INTEGER_32 maximum_width: INTEGER_32 may_contain (v: EV_WIDGET): BOOLEAN menu_bar: detachable EV_MENU_BAR merged_radio_button_groups: detachable ARRAYED_LIST [EV_CONTAINER] minimum_height: INTEGER_32 minimum_width: INTEGER_32 mode_is_configurable_target_menu: BOOLEAN mode_is_drag_and_drop: BOOLEAN mode_is_pick_and_drop: BOOLEAN mode_is_target_menu: BOOLEAN new_cursor: ITERATION_CURSOR [EV_WIDGET] object_comparison: BOOLEAN object_id: INTEGER_32 parent: detachable EV_CONTAINER parent_of_source_allows_docking: BOOLEAN pebble: detachable ANY pebble_function: detachable FUNCTION [detachable ANY] pebble_positioning_enabled: BOOLEAN pebble_x_position: INTEGER_32 pebble_y_position: INTEGER_32 pointer_position: EV_COORDINATE pointer_style: EV_POINTER_STYLE prunable: BOOLEAN readable: BOOLEAN real_source: detachable EV_DOCKABLE_SOURCE real_target: detachable EV_DOCKABLE_TARGET screen_x: INTEGER_32 screen_y: INTEGER_32 scroll_area_files: EV_SCROLLABLE_AREA scroll_area_tools: EV_SCROLLABLE_AREA Shared_environment: EV_ENVIRONMENT source_has_current_recursive (source: EV_DOCKABLE_SOURCE): BOOLEAN target_data_function: detachable FUNCTION [[like pebble] detachable ANY, EV_PND_TARGET_DATA] target_name: detachable READABLE_STRING_GENERAL title: STRING_32 tools_column: SD_TOOL_BAR user_can_resize: BOOLEAN veto_dock_function: detachable FUNCTION [EV_DOCKABLE_SOURCE, BOOLEAN] width: INTEGER_32 writable: BOOLEAN x_position: INTEGER_32 y_position: INTEGER_32 Commands center_pointer cl_extend (v: [like item] EV_WIDGET) cl_prune (v: [like item] EV_WIDGET) cl_put (v: [like item] EV_WIDGET) compare_objects compare_references destroy destroy_and_exit_if_last disable_border disable_capture disable_dockable disable_docking disable_external_docking disable_external_docking_relative disable_pebble_positioning disable_sensitive disable_user_resize disconnect_from_window_manager dispose enable_border enable_capture enable_dockable enable_docking enable_external_docking enable_external_docking_relative enable_pebble_positioning enable_sensitive enable_user_resize extend (v: [like item] EV_WIDGET) fill (other: CONTAINER [EV_WIDGET]) free_id hide lock_update merge_radio_button_groups (other: EV_CONTAINER) propagate_background_color propagate_foreground_color prune (v: EV_WIDGET) prune_all (v: EV_WIDGET) put (v: [like item] EV_WIDGET) refresh_now remove_background_pixmap remove_default_key_processing_handler remove_help_context remove_menu_bar remove_pebble remove_real_source remove_real_target remove_title replace (v: [like item] EV_WIDGET) set_accept_cursor (a_cursor: [detachable like accept_cursor] detachable EV_POINTER_STYLE) set_actual_drop_target_agent (an_agent: [like actual_drop_target_agent] detachable FUNCTION [INTEGER_32, INTEGER_32, detachable EV_ABSTRACT_PICK_AND_DROPABLE]) set_background_color (a_color: [like background_color] EV_COLOR) set_background_pixmap (a_pixmap: EV_PIXMAP) set_configurable_target_menu_handler (a_handler: detachable PROCEDURE [EV_MENU, ARRAYED_LIST [EV_PND_TARGET_DATA], EV_PICK_AND_DROPABLE, detachable ANY]) set_configurable_target_menu_mode set_data (some_data: [like data] detachable ANY) set_default_colors set_default_key_processing_handler (a_handler: [like default_key_processing_handler] detachable PREDICATE [EV_KEY]) set_deny_cursor (a_cursor: [detachable like deny_cursor] detachable EV_POINTER_STYLE) set_drag_and_drop_mode set_focus set_foreground_color (a_color: [like foreground_color] EV_COLOR) set_height (a_height: INTEGER_32) set_help_context (an_help_context: FUNCTION [EV_HELP_CONTEXT]) set_identifier_name (a_name: READABLE_STRING_GENERAL) set_maximum_height (a_maximum_height: INTEGER_32) set_maximum_size (a_maximum_width, a_maximum_height: INTEGER_32) set_maximum_width (a_maximum_width: INTEGER_32) set_menu_bar (a_menu_bar: EV_MENU_BAR) set_minimum_height (a_minimum_height: INTEGER_32) set_minimum_size (a_minimum_width, a_minimum_height: INTEGER_32) set_minimum_width (a_minimum_width: INTEGER_32) set_pebble (a_pebble: ANY) set_pebble_function (a_function: FUNCTION [detachable ANY]) set_pebble_position (a_x, a_y: INTEGER_32) set_pick_and_drop_mode set_pointer_style (a_cursor: EV_POINTER_STYLE) set_position (a_x, a_y: INTEGER_32) set_real_source (dockable_source: EV_DOCKABLE_SOURCE) set_real_target (a_target: EV_DOCKABLE_TARGET) set_size (a_width, a_height: INTEGER_32) set_target_data_function (a_function: FUNCTION [[like pebble] detachable ANY, EV_PND_TARGET_DATA]) set_target_menu_mode set_target_name (a_name: READABLE_STRING_GENERAL) set_title (a_title: separate READABLE_STRING_GENERAL) set_veto_dock_function (a_function: FUNCTION [EV_DOCKABLE_SOURCE, BOOLEAN]) set_width (a_width: INTEGER_32) set_x_position (a_x: INTEGER_32) set_y_position (a_y: INTEGER_32) show show_configurable_target_menu (a_x, a_y: INTEGER_32) show_relative_to_window (a_parent: EV_WINDOW) unlock_update unmerge_radio_button_groups (other: EV_CONTAINER) wipe_out Constraints internal docking manager not void all files column are tool bar button all tools column are tool bar button
Classes Clusters Cluster hierarchy Chart Relations Flat contracts Go to:

-- Generated by Eiffel Studio --
For more details: eiffel.org